Key inclusion criteria 1)Females aged 35-49 years.
2)Subjects who are healthy and are not suffered from chronic disease including skin disease.
3)Subjects who are aware of skin dryness.
4)Subjects who can make self-judgment and are voluntarily giving written informed consent.
5)Subjects who can have an examination on a designated check day.
6)Subjects who are judged as suitable for the current study by the investigator.
Key exclusion criteria Subjects (who)
1)contract disease and are under treatment.
2)with skin disease, such as atopic dermatitis.
3)with strange skin conditions at measurement points.
4)used a drug to treat a disease in the past 1 month.
5)used antibiotics within the last 2 weeks prior to the screening and pre-intake test.
6)have a history of and/or contract serious diseases (eg, liver disease, kidney disease, heart disease, lung disease, blood disease).
7)have a history and/or contract digestive disease.
8)with serious anemia.
9)whose BMI are 30 or more.
10)have allergic reaction to ingredients of test foods and other foods or drugs.
11)have a habit to use drugs claiming to improve skin function in the past 3 months.
12)have a habit to use Foods with Function Claims, functional foods and/or supplements claiming to improve skin function in the past 3 months and/or are planning to use those foods during test periods.
13)have a habit to take foods related to green juice in the past 3 months and/or are planning to use those foods during test periods.
14)regularly take foods containing lactic acid bacteria, bifidobacteria, oligosaccharides, and/or viable bacteria.
15)are or are possibly pregnant, or are lactating.
16)have excessive alcohol intake more than 20 g/day of pure alcohol equivalent.
17)with psychiatric disease.
18)are smokers.
19)with possible changes of life style during test periods.
20)will develop seasonal allergy symptoms, such as pollinosis, eye and nose symptoms and/or use an anti-allergic drug.
21)neglect skin care.
22)can't avoid direct sunlight exposure, such as sunburn, during test periods.
23)had been conducted an operation or beauty treatment on the test spot in the past 6 months.
24)are participating and/or had participated in other clinical studies within the last 3 months.
25)are judged as unsuitable for the current study by the investigator for other reasons.

Number of participants that the trial has enrolled 50
Results Statistically significant difference was confirmed in the primary outcome.
Results date posted
2021 Year 12 Month 24 Day
Results Delayed
Results Delay Reason
Date of the first journal publication of results
Baseline Characteristics Females aged 35 to 49 years old.
Participant flow Enrolled(n=50)
Completed(n=49)
Analysed(n=39)
Adverse events No adverse events were observed that be related to test food.
Outcome measures Skin moisture content
